One of the most prominent forms of entertainment in Europe is music. From classical to contemporary, Europe is home to some of the world’s most talented musicians and performers. Cities such as Vienna, Berlin, and Paris have long been renowned for their classical music scene, with numerous symphonies, operas, and ballets performed throughout the year. In addition, Europe is also home to many popular music festivals such as Glastonbury, Roskilde, and Tomorrowland, attracting music lovers from all over the world.

The theater is another important aspect of European entertainment. With a rich history dating back to the ancient Greeks, Europe has been at the forefront of theatrical innovation for centuries. From Shakespearean plays in London’s West End to modern experimental theater in Berlin, there is no shortage of high-quality productions to choose from. In addition to traditional theater, many European cities also offer alternative forms of performance art such as stand-up comedy, improv, and circus acts.

Film is yet another area where Europe excels. European cinema has a long and illustrious history, with iconic directors such as Ingmar Bergman, Federico Fellini, and Jean-Luc Godard paving the way for modern cinema. Today, many European countries offer generous incentives for film production, leading to a thriving industry with high-quality films that have gained international recognition. Festivals such as the Cannes Film Festival and the Berlin International Film Festival have become global institutions, attracting film lovers and industry professionals from all over the world.

Gaming is another area where Europe is making a name for itself. The video game industry in Europe is a rapidly growing sector, with many successful game developers such as Ubisoft, Mojang, and Paradox Interactive based in the region. The esports industry is also booming, with numerous tournaments and events held throughout Europe each year. Gaming cafes and bars have also become increasingly popular, providing a social and communal space for gamers to gather and enjoy their favorite games together.
